This is our first annual conference!

Description: This is not a "sit around and listen to a few presenters" sort of conference. Instead, we're going to have a bunch of small workshops where we present about an area, and then the whole group works about developing it further. Current schedule:

Intro

* Vision (why the world needs seasteads)
* Roads (how to make seasteading happen)
* Introduce Day's Agenda
* TSI Engineering Consultants presentation on ocean platform design

Workshops

* Coaststead Business Ideas: The VC-funded path.
* DIY Seasteading: The self-funded path.
* Ephemerisle Planning/Meta-Planning: The Burning Man path.
* Government/Constitution/Organization: How will seasteads be governed?

Closing
* Continuing Engagement - Social networks, volunteer projects, ...
* Wrap-up
